Community Food Initiative

FADA is currently working on a model to allow a community food initiative to flourish in the Kildare region.

Key Strategies to do this are

• Setting up a Food Buying Club — or several, depending on demand, as a first step towards setting up a community food co-op

• Setting up a pilot CSA (Community Supported Agriculture) project — or several, depending on feedback and demand.

• Work towards establishing a Community Processing Kitchen that meets health and safety standards to allow small micro-food processing businesses to establish and to run cooking courses.

• Work towards establishing a research unit to explore methods of extending growing season and range of food that can be grown in the region.
